DAG-направленный ациклический граф и Lightning Network LN

Криптовалюта

DAG (направленный ациклический граф) и Молниеносная сеть (LN) — две новые технологии в области блокчейна и криптовалюты. Оба нацелены на решение некоторых существующих проблем в традиционных сетях блокчейнов, таких как масштабируемость и комиссии за транзакции.

DAG — это структура данных, представляющая собой ориентированный граф без циклов. Он приобрел популярность как потенциальное решение проблемы масштабируемости в сетях блокчейна. В отличие от традиционных сетей блокчейнов, где транзакции организованы в линейные цепочки, DAG позволяет осуществлять параллельную обработку транзакций. Это означает, что несколько транзакций могут быть подтверждены одновременно, что приводит к увеличению скорости транзакций.

С другой стороны, Lightning Network — это протокол уровня 2, который работает поверх сети блокчейн. Он обеспечивает транзакции вне цепочки, то есть транзакции, которые происходят вне основного блокчейна. Сохраняя большинство транзакций вне сети, сеть Lightning Network способна значительно снизить комиссию за транзакции и увеличить пропускную способность транзакций. Сеть Lightning достигает этого за счет создания сети платежных каналов, где пользователи могут совершать мгновенные и недорогие транзакции между собой, не полагаясь на основной блокчейн для каждой транзакции.

И DAG, и Lightning Network могут революционизировать способы использования блокчейна и криптовалют.В этой статье мы рассмотрим основные концепции DAG и Lightning Network, их преимущества и недостатки, а также их потенциальное влияние на будущее технологии блокчейн.

1. Введение в DAG и LN:

DAG, или направленный ациклический граф, — это структура данных, представляющая конечный набор вершин или узлов, соединенных направленными ребрами или дугами. В отличие от традиционных структур блокчейна, в которых используется линейная цепочка блоков, DAG обеспечивают более гибкую и масштабируемую сетевую архитектуру.

Lightning Network (LN) — это решение для масштабирования сетей блокчейнов, предназначенное для обеспечения быстрых и недорогих транзакций. Он построен на основе существующих сетей блокчейнов, таких как Биткойн, и использует платежные каналы для облегчения транзакций вне цепочки.

Промокоды на Займер на скидки

Займы для физических лиц под низкий процент

  • 💲Сумма: от 2 000 до 30 000 рублей
  • 🕑Срок: от 7 до 30 дней
  • 👍Первый заём для новых клиентов — 0%, повторный — скидка 500 руб

Объединив технологии DAG и LN, разработчики и исследователи работают над созданием более масштабируемой и эффективной сети. В этой статье будут рассмотрены концепции DAG и LN и то, как их можно использовать для повышения производительности и масштабируемости сетей блокчейнов.

а. Краткое объяснение DAG и его роли в криптовалютах.

В мире криптовалют направленный ациклический граф (DAG) — это структура данных, которая используется для упрощения механизма консенсуса и обеспечения масштабируемости. В отличие от традиционных структур блокчейна, которые полагаются на линейные цепочки блоков, DAG предлагают другой подход к достижению консенсуса и обработке транзакций.

DAG — это граф, состоящий из набора вершин и направленных ребер, где направленные ребра идут только в одном направлении и циклов нет. Каждая вершина представляет транзакцию, а направленные ребра представляют зависимости между транзакциями. Это означает, что для того, чтобы транзакция считалась действительной, все ее зависимости уже должны быть обработаны и подтверждены сетью.

В контексте криптовалют DAG часто используются в таких протоколах, как Lightning Network (LN).Lightning Network — это решение масштабирования второго уровня, предназначенное для решения проблем масштабируемости сетей блокчейнов, таких как Биткойн. Он использует сеть платежных каналов, которые представлены комбинацией смарт-контрактов и оффчейн-транзакций.

Группы DAG играют жизненно важную роль в архитектуре сети Lightning, позволяя создавать каналы оплаты и поддерживать их состояние. Каждый канал оплаты представлен как серия направленных ребер в DAG, где каждое ребро соответствует платежному обязательству между участвующими сторонами. Использование DAG позволяет эффективно и безопасно маршрутизировать платежи внутри сети Lightning, а также быстро разрешать споры или закрывать каналы.

В целом, DAG предлагают гибкую и масштабируемую альтернативу традиционным структурам блокчейна в мире криптовалют. Их роль в таких протоколах, как Lightning Network, подчеркивает их способность облегчать эффективную обработку транзакций и обеспечивать масштабируемость вне цепочки, что делает их важным компонентом в эволюции криптовалютных сетей.

б. Краткое объяснение LN и его роли в криптовалютах

Lightning Network (LN) — это протокол второго уровня, построенный на основе блокчейна (чаще всего связанного с Биткойном), целью которого является улучшение масштабируемости и скорости транзакций. Он предназначен для ускорения и удешевления микротранзакций за счет создания сети двунаправленных платежных каналов между пользователями. LN работает, проводя транзакции вне цепочки, то есть они не записываются в базовый блокчейн до тех пор, пока канал не будет закрыт.

LN помогает решить проблемы масштабируемости, с которыми сталкиваются сети блокчейнов, такие как Биткойн, путем маршрутизации транзакций через сеть взаимосвязанных каналов, а не выполнения каждой транзакции непосредственно в блокчейне. Это значительно уменьшает перегрузку и увеличивает количество транзакций, которые можно обрабатывать быстрее и эффективнее.

Сеть Lightning значительно повышает удобство использования криптовалют, обеспечивая практически мгновенные транзакции с минимальными комиссиями. Он позволяет пользователям отправлять и получать платежи, не дожидаясь подтверждений в блокчейне, что делает его пригодным для различных случаев использования, таких как микротранзакции, платежные каналы и атомарные свопы. LN также позволяет создавать децентрализованные приложения (dApps), которые могут использовать преимущества быстрых и дешевых транзакций.

Кроме того, LN предлагает высокую степень конфиденциальности и безопасности, поскольку транзакции между участвующими сторонами в рамках платежных каналов проводятся конфиденциально. Единственные транзакции, которые фиксируются в блокчейне, — это открытие и закрытие платежных каналов.

2. Понимание DAG:

В информатике ориентированный ациклический граф (DAG) — это ориентированный граф, не имеющий циклов. Это тип графа, в котором ребра имеют определенное направление и в графе нет петель или циклов. Эта структура обычно используется в различных приложениях, таких как обработка данных, цифровые валюты и сетевые протоколы, такие как Lightning Network (LN).

DAG состоит из вершин и ребер, где вершины представляют отдельные узлы или элементы, а ребра представляют отношения между этими узлами. Каждый узел графа может иметь несколько исходящих ребер, но циклов нет, то есть нет путей, которые возвращаются к одному и тому же узлу после прохождения через другие узлы.

Отсутствие циклов в DAG позволяет использовать эффективные алгоритмы обработки и обхода. В контексте сети Lightning DAG используется для представления каналов оплаты между узлами. Каждый узел в сети представлен в виде вершины, а каналы оплаты между узлами представлены в виде направленных ребер. Это позволяет сети Lightning эффективно и безопасно направлять платежи через сеть.

Используя структуру DAG, сеть Lightning Network может выполнять быстрые, недорогие и масштабируемые транзакции, используя свойства DAG. Эта структура позволяет сети Lightning направлять платежи через несколько каналов, создавая сеть взаимосвязанных платежных каналов, которая может облегчить мгновенные транзакции и снизить потребность в транзакциях в цепочке.

Использование DAG в сети Lightning Network позволяет создавать гибкие платежные каналы, которые можно динамически обновлять по мере необходимости. Это позволяет пользователям устанавливать и закрывать каналы в любое время, не требуя прямой внутрисетевой транзакции. В результате сеть Lightning обеспечивает решение проблем масштабируемости, с которыми сталкиваются традиционные сети блокчейнов.

Основные принципы понятны: Вопросы и ответы для понимания основ криптовалюты

Что такое ДАГ?
DAG означает направленный ациклический граф. Это структура данных, состоящая из узлов и направленных ребер, в которой ребра идут только в одном направлении и циклы отсутствуют.
Как работает DAG?
В группе обеспечения доступности баз данных каждый узел представляет задачу или событие, а направленные ребра между узлами представляют зависимости между задачами или событиями. Это означает, что задача или событие может быть выполнено или произойти только после того, как все его зависимости завершены или произошли.
Какова связь между DAG и сетью Lightning?
Lightning Network — это масштабируемое решение для блокчейна Биткойн, которое использует сеть платежных каналов для обеспечения быстрых и дешевых транзакций. Каналы оплаты в сети Lightning представлены в виде ориентированного ациклического графа (DAG), где каждый канал представляет собой узел, а транзакции между каналами представляют собой направленные ребра.
Можете ли вы объяснить, как Lightning Network и DAG работают вместе?
Конечно! В сети Lightning каналы оплаты изначально создаются между двумя сторонами в блокчейне Биткойн. Эти каналы представлены как узлы в группе обеспечения доступности баз данных.Когда необходимо совершить транзакцию между двумя сторонами, у которых нет прямого канала оплаты, транзакция может быть маршрутизирована через сеть каналов в DAG. Это позволяет осуществлять мгновенные и недорогие транзакции без необходимости проведения каждой транзакции в блокчейне Биткойна.

❓За участие в опросе консультация бесплатно